Output 1d45e896aef63683a2fd3bb5e3c471705baaacf470eb6a06a248e5c92956b31e:4

value
653529847
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42ce47c4cbe97f47a33e291fd3011d142acb3078 OP_EQUAL
address
37nFdpBbq4NmA14y7VSiWR4xevDDPZ7fe2
transaction
1d45e896aef63683a2fd3bb5e3c471705baaacf470eb6a06a248e5c92956b31e
confirmations
319895
spent
true